Taiwan’s #MeToo movement has shown that sexual misconduct in the country is as much about gender inequality as it is about abuse of power. Men, too, were among those publicly standing up against their abusers. But victims across the world face the same problem — speaking up can ruin their lives. We bring you the second part of our conversation on Taiwan’s ongoing #MeToo movement. We are once again joined by Darice Chang, an ambassador for Women's March Taiwan, and JhuCin Rita Jhang, a project assistant professor at National Taiwan University and host of a podcast on gender issues.
